Ingredients
For the cake:
- 2 ½ cups all-purpose flour
- 2 teaspoons baking powder
- 1 teaspoon baking soda
- ½ teaspoon salt
- 2 tablespoons cocoa powder
- 2 cups granulated sugar
- ½ cup (1 stick) butter, softened
- 2 large eggs
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
- 1 cup buttermilk
- 2 tablespoons red food coloring
For the frosting:
- 8 ounces cream cheese, softened
- ½ cup (1 stick) butter, softened
- 4 cups confectioners' sugar
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
- 2-3 tablespoons heavy cream
Instructions
1. Preheat oven to 350 degrees F (175 degrees C). Grease and flour two 9-inch round cake pans.
2. In a medium bowl, sift together the flour, baking powder, baking soda, salt, and cocoa powder. Set aside.
3. In a large bowl, cream together the sugar and butter until light and fluffy. Beat in the eggs one at a time, then stir in the vanilla. Beat in the flour mixture alternately with the buttermilk, mixing just until incorporated. Stir in the red food coloring.
4. Divide the batter evenly between the prepared pans. Bake for 30 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ted into the center of the cake comes out clean. Let cool in the pans for 10 minutes, then turn out onto a wire rack to cool completely.
5. To make the frosting, beat the cream cheese and butter until light and fluffy. Gradually beat in the confectioners' sugar until smooth. Beat in the vanilla and cream, adding more cream if needed for desired consistency.
6. To assemble the cake, place one layer on a serving plate. Spread the top with frosting. Top with the second layer, and spread the top and sides with remaining frosting.

Tips for Serving
This red velvet wedding cake is best served at room temperature. It will keep in the refrigerator for up to 5 days, or can be frozen for up to 3 months. When serving, we recommend topping with fresh berries or edible flowers for an extra special touch.
Variations
This red velvet wedding cake can be made with any type of frosting you prefer. You can also add chopped nuts, chocolate chips, or shredded coconut to the cake batter for a bit of extra flavor and texture.
